探索Node.js实现远程桌面分享:高效协作新纪元
node远程桌面分享

首页 2024-10-24 02:10:03



探索Node.js在远程桌面分享领域的革新应用 在数字化时代,远程工作与合作已成为常态,而远程桌面分享技术作为连接不同地理位置团队成员的桥梁,其重要性不言而喻

    传统上,这一领域多由专用软件或操作系统内置功能主导,但近年来,随着Node.js这一高性能、轻量级的JavaScript运行环境的兴起,它正悄然改变着远程桌面分享的面貌,为用户带来了前所未有的便捷与高效

     Node.js:为远程桌面分享注入新活力 Node.js以其非阻塞I/O模型、事件驱动机制和V8引擎的强大性能,在实时通信、Web服务开发等领域展现出卓越能力

    这些特性恰好契合了远程桌面分享对于低延迟、高并发连接的需求,使得基于Node.js构建的远程桌面分享解决方案能够轻松应对大规模用户同时在线、实时交互的场景

     实时性与流畅性的双重保障 在远程桌面分享中,实时性与流畅性是衡量体验好坏的关键指标

    Node.js通过其内置的WebSockets或结合第三方库(如Socket.IO)实现的全双工通信机制,确保了数据传输的低延迟与高效率

    这意味着用户可以几乎无感知地进行屏幕共享、文件传输、远程操作等操作,无论是进行远程会议、在线教育还是技术支持,都能获得如临其境的交互体验

     跨平台兼容性与灵活性 Node.js的跨平台特性使得基于它构建的远程桌面分享应用能够轻松部署在Windows、macOS、Linux等多种操作系统上,极大地拓宽了用户群体

    同时,JavaScript作为前端开发的主流语言,其广泛的开发者基础也为Node.js应用的快速迭代与功能扩展提供了有力支持

    这意味着开发者可以更加灵活地根据用户需求,快速调整产品功能,优化用户体验

     安全性的强化 远程桌面分享涉及敏感信息的传输,因此安全性至关重要

    Node.js社区提供了丰富的安全库和最佳实践,帮助开发者构建安全的远程桌面分享系统

    通过实施TLS/SSL加密、身份验证机制、数据隔离等措施,可以有效防止数据泄露、中间人攻击等安全风险,保障用户数据安全

     定制化与集成能力的展现 Node.js的模块化设计使得远程桌面分享应用能够轻松实现高度定制化与集成化

    企业可以根据自身业务需求,定制专属的远程协作平台,将远程桌面分享功能无缝集成到现有的办公系统、CRM系统或项目管理工具中,实现工作流程的自动化与协同效率的最大化

     结语 综上所述,Node.js以其独特的优势,在远程桌面分享领域展现出了巨大的潜力与价值

    它不仅为用户提供了更加流畅、实时的远程协作体验,还通过跨平台兼容性、安全性强化以及高度的定制化与集成能力,为企业打造了更加灵活、高效的远程工作解决方案

    随着技术的不断进步和应用的持续深化,我们有理由相信,基于Node.js的远程桌面分享技术将在未来发挥更加重要的作用,推动远程工作模式的进一步发展